NAME
RkXfer - change the current candidate
SYNOPSIS
#include <canna/RK.h> int RkXfer(cxnum, knum) int cxnum; int knum;
DESCRIPTION
RkXfer sets the candidate with a specified candidate number knum as the current candidate. The candidate number must be 0 or greater but less than the highest candidate number in the current clause. The current clause does not change when a candidate number outside this range is specified.
RETURN VALUE
If successful, this function moves the current candidate in the context and returns the candidate number after the move. It returns 0, without doing anything, if it has been run in a nonconversion mode context. RKXFER(3)
